site stats

Merge without commit

http://xlab.zju.edu.cn/git/help/user/project/merge_requests/methods/index.md Web14 mrt. 2024 · Squash merging is a merge option that allows you to condense the Git history of topic branches when you complete a pull request. Instead of each commit on the topic branch being added to the history of the default branch, a squash merge adds all the file changes to a single new commit on the default branch. Squash merge commit …

What is a fast-forward merge in Git - TutorialsPoint

Web30 apr. 2024 · Fast forward merge can be performed when there is a direct linear path from the source branch to the target branch. In fast-forward merge, git simply moves the source branch pointer to the target branch pointer without creating an extra merge commit. Let us look at an example implementing fast-forward merge. We have a master branch with 3 … WebMerge commit ( --no-ff) DEFAULT : Always create a new merge commit and update the target branch to it, even if the source branch is already up to date with the target branch. Fast-forward ( --ff ): If the source branch is out of date with the target branch, create a merge commit. hay river hotels nwt https://stephanesartorius.com

What is git commit, push, pull, log, aliases, fetch, config & clone

Web14 dec. 2024 · Prevent merge conflicts. Git is good at automatically merging file changes in most circumstances, as long as the file contents don't change dramatically between commits. If your branch is far behind your main branch, consider rebasing your branches before you open a pull request. Rebased branches will merge into your main branch … Web30 apr. 2024 · Decide if you want to keep only your hotfix or master changes, or write a completely new code. Delete the conflict markers before merging your changes. When you're ready to merge, all you have to do is run git add command on the conflicted files to tell Git they're resolved.; Commit your changes with git commit to generate the merge … WebThere are technically several different strategies to 'undo' a commit. The following examples will assume we have a commit history that looks like: git log --oneline 872 fa7e Try something crazy a1e8fb5 Make some important changes to hello .txt 435 b61d Create hello .txt 9773 e52 Initial import hay river hub newspaper

[Sourcetree]How can i merge brances without commit...

Category:Apply changes from one Git branch to another JetBrains Rider

Tags:Merge without commit

Merge without commit

Merging Changes using Visual Studio - mohitgoyal.co

Web1 feb. 2009 · git merge --no-commit won't abort a merge if it can be fast forwarded. git merge --abort doesn't work if it was merged. If you want to write this as a script, it's … WebThe --no-commit prevents the MERGE COMMIT from occuring, and that only happens when you merge two divergent branch histories; in your example that's not the case since Git indicates that it was a "fast-forward" merge and then Git only applies the commits …

Merge without commit

Did you know?

Web14 jul. 2014 · Yes, it is still a merge. It doesn't matter whether you run git merge , or git merge --no-commit , the result will be a merge commit, … Web25 feb. 2024 · From the man pages: “Recreate merge commits instead of flattening the history by replaying commits a merge commit introduces. Merge conflict resolutions or manual amendments to merge commits are not preserved.” However, our recorded conflicts were not being applied even after training git-rerere since the conflict resolutions …

WebNext, find the commit hash of the merge with git log: That will generate a list of commits that looks something like this: git log --oneline. The commit hash is the seven character string in the beginning of each line. In this case, `52bc98d` is our merge’s hash. Once you have that, you can pass it to the git revert command to undo the merge: WebYou can use the git reset command to return to the revision before the merge, thereby effectively undoing it: $ git reset --hard If you don't have the hash of the commit before the merge at hand, you can also use the following variation of the command: $ git reset --hard HEAD~1

WebTo incorporate the new commits into your feature branch, you have two options: merging or rebasing. The Merge Option The easiest option is to merge the main branch into the feature branch using something like the following: git checkout feature git merge main Or, you can condense this to a one-liner: git merge feature main Web7 aug. 2024 · merge, as your /feature is directly following the HEAD of dev branch, you branch will merge without creating "new merge commit" (see first GIF). Observation Ok rebase, needs a little more steps compared to merge, but this was useful to me, i can improve tests and avoid bugs.

WebDigirocket Technologies. Apr 2024 - Present1 year 1 month. United States. Enhancing online presence in today's fast pace world is imperative if you want to get good acquisition and sales. My role ...

Web8 okt. 2024 · Merge without commit feature needed. 48 votes. Upvote. GitKraken will perform a merge without a commit if there is a conflict, however I would like to be able to review and potentially unstage certain diffs before instructing GitKraken to continue with the merge and commit. I realize GitKraken already has a merge conflict editor, what I want … hay river housing authorityWeb9 jun. 2024 · Using Git Merge Without Commit. If you type the man command next to Git Merge ( man git merge) in your command prompt, you will open the HELP page for that specific command. That’s where you can read its documentation and all additional arguments that you can later use to further customize its operations. hay river legion facebookWeb基于此,我们希望在merge commit的时候,忽略图片的检查压缩。 git hooks. git hook其实就是git在特定事件(比如commit、push、merge等)触发前后会执行的特定脚本。我们最广泛使用的是pre-commit hook, 通常在提交前lint代码,以确保糟糕的代码不会被提交。 hay river issues that matter facebookWebWith --no-commit perform the merge and stop just before creating a merge commit, to give the user a chance to inspect and further tweak the merge result before committing. Note … hay river issues that matterWeb12 jul. 2024 · git help merge コマンドを実行すると、このコマンドのヘルプページが表示されます。 ヘルプページには、git merge コマンドがデフォルトでコミットを呼び出すことが示されています。--commit 引数を渡して、変更をマージしてコミットできます。--no-commit フラグを渡してマージし、Git がコミットを ... bottom ankle painWebThe current branch and HEAD pointer stay at the last commit successfully made.. The CHERRY_PICK_HEAD ref is set to point at the commit that introduced the change that is difficult to apply.. Paths in which the change applied cleanly are updated both in the index file and in your working tree. For conflicting paths, the index file records up to three … hay river legionWeb17 dec. 2024 · The prompt is actually there for humans who have to edit git merges, and any text you add in is simply a notice ot other developers who might be looking at what you wrote. You have to exit the editor the same way you would if you were using it from a standard terminal screen. Exit git Merges that Ask for Commit Messages Generally, … bottom antonyms